Abstract Turtle Art 209 Burnett Avenue Ventura (805) 320-2377 naroz1@ix.netcom.com Abstract art that is painted by two turtles.
There is no human intervention at all, turtles do all the paintings. Must see to believe it.
Paintings are on staple free canvas ( no need to frame it) and can be mounted 4 different ways.